The half life of DNA in preserved dead tissue or bone has been estimated at between about 350 and 500 years in perfect preservation conditions. However, inside a living body, biological processes break down the DNA and RNA much faster. https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C3497090/ https://pubmed.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/27317895/ https://academic.oup.com/dnaresearch/article/16/1/45/364974
